面向复杂场景的RRT路径规划优化算法研究

一、算法研究背景与核心问题

在自主移动机器人、工业机械臂及无人机导航领域,传统RRT(快速扩展随机树)算法存在两大核心缺陷:其一,单树生长机制导致搜索空间覆盖效率低下,在复杂障碍物环境中易陷入局部最优;其二,生成的路径包含大量锯齿状转折点,无法直接满足机械系统的运动学约束。2010年某研究团队在《电子学报》发表的改进型RRT算法,通过双向扩展策略与非完整性约束机制,系统性解决了上述问题。

该算法创新性地引入目标引力采样机制,通过计算节点到目标的欧氏距离与角度偏差构建综合引力场,使随机树生长方向更具导向性。实验数据显示,在20×20m三维仿真场景中,算法可在0.5秒内完成路径规划,较传统RRT算法效率提升45%,路径曲率连续性指标达到工业级应用标准。

二、核心技术创新体系

1. 双向多步扩展搜索架构

传统RRT算法采用单树随机扩展方式,在复杂环境中易出现搜索空间碎片化问题。改进算法构建双向搜索树(RRT-Connect),通过交替扩展机制实现空间覆盖效率的指数级提升。具体实现包含三个关键步骤:

  • 初始节点配对:在起点与目标点分别构建初始树T1、T2
  • 多步扩展策略:每轮迭代中T1扩展k步后,T2从最近节点反向扩展k步
  • 动态步长调整:根据障碍物密度自动调节扩展步长(2-5个单位长度)

该架构通过并行搜索缩小解空间范围,实验表明在包含50个随机障碍物的测试场景中,双向扩展使路径搜索耗时从平均12.3秒降至6.8秒。

2. 非完整性运动约束建模

针对车辆、机械臂等非完整系统,算法引入微分约束方程:

  1. dx/dt = v*cosθ
  2. dy/dt = v*sinθ
  3. dθ/dt = v*tanφ/L

其中(v,φ)为线速度与转向角,L为轴距。通过将运动学约束嵌入节点扩展准则,有效消除传统RRT生成的物理不可行路径。在转向半径限制为3m的测试中,非法路径比例从27%降至1.2%。

3. 三次B样条路径平滑处理

采用参数化曲线拟合技术对离散路径点进行优化,控制点选取遵循以下原则:

  • 首末控制点与路径起点/终点重合
  • 中间控制点基于局部曲率极值点动态插入
  • 权重系数ω根据障碍物距离动态调整(ω∈[0.7,1.3])

拟合后的路径满足G²连续性要求(位置、切线、曲率连续),在某自动驾驶测试平台验证中,路径曲率峰值从3.2rad/m降至1.38rad/m,车辆转向频率降低41%。

三、技术实现关键细节

1. 引力场采样策略实现

构建目标引力函数时,综合考虑空间距离与方向偏差:

  1. F_attr = w1*exp(-d/λ) + w2*(1-cosΔθ)

其中d为节点到目标距离,Δθ为方向夹角,权重系数w1=0.7,w2=0.3通过网格搜索法优化确定。采样过程中,以引力场值作为概率权重进行节点选择,使搜索方向更趋近最优路径。

2. 冗余节点优化算法

采用改进的Dijkstra算法进行路径简化,核心步骤包括:

  1. 构建节点邻接图,边权重为欧氏距离与角度变化量的加权和
  2. 执行贪心算法删除冗余中间节点
  3. 保留曲率变化超过阈值(0.05rad/m)的关键转折点

该优化使路径节点数减少62%,同时保持98.7%的路径相似度。在机械臂轨迹规划测试中,关节空间轨迹生成时间从4.2秒缩短至1.6秒。

3. 动态环境适应机制

针对移动障碍物场景,算法集成实时避障模块:

  • 预测层:基于卡尔曼滤波预测障碍物未来3秒位置
  • 决策层:采用滚动优化策略,每0.5秒重新规划局部路径
  • 执行层:通过贝塞尔曲线实现轨迹平滑过渡

在10m/s相对速度的动态测试中,算法成功避障率达到97.3%,较传统反应式避障方法提升31个百分点。

四、实验验证与行业影响

1. 标准化测试环境验证

在Gazebo仿真平台构建的标准化测试场景中,算法展现显著优势:
| 指标 | 传统RRT | 改进算法 | 提升幅度 |
|——————————-|————-|—————|—————|
| 规划耗时(秒) | 8.7 | 4.2 | 51.7% |
| 路径长度(米) | 28.4 | 26.9 | 5.3% |
| 曲率峰值(rad/m) | 2.8 | 1.2 | 57.1% |
| 重复规划一致性 | 78% | 92% | 18% |

2. 工业应用案例

某物流机器人企业采用该算法后,AGV设备运行效率提升显著:

  • 仓储场景:路径规划时间从3.2秒降至1.4秒
  • 转弯半径:最小转弯半径缩小至1.2m
  • 能源消耗:单位距离能耗降低19%

3. 学术影响力分析

截至2023年,该研究成果已被:

  • 56篇中英文论文引用
  • 8项国家自然科学基金项目采用
  • 写入《自主移动机器人路径规划技术规范》行业标准
    衍生出HJB-RRT、EB-RRT*等改进算法,在电力巡检机器人领域实现规模化部署。

五、未来发展方向

当前研究正朝三个维度深化:

  1. 多模态融合:结合激光雷达与视觉数据提升环境感知精度
  2. 群体协同规划:开发多机器人路径协调优化算法
  3. 学习增强机制:集成深度强化学习提升复杂场景适应能力

某研究团队最新成果显示,融合神经网络预测的RRT*算法在未知环境探索中,路径质量指标较传统方法提升28%,预示着智能路径规划技术的新发展方向。